### v3.8.0 — Setting renamed in Cartwheel catalog cache

Heads up: CATALOG_FLUSH_KEY is now CARTWHEEL_INVALIDATION_TOKEN. The old name silently no-op'd after we split the invalidation worker out of the main catalog service, which is why stale prices lingered on Tuesday. Migration is just a rename in the env file — same value, new key. The deploy script won't warn if it's missing, so double-check before cutting the release. Drop the old line and add the new one right here.

vault entry, yahif-yajep: COURIER_KEY29=b802bdf8034096b65a51c6ba5abe2

Step 6: Broker upgrade. Drain consumers on Quillbus node-b, confirm queue depth is zero, then roll the new broker binary. Do not upgrade both nodes at once; mirrored queues need one live peer. After node-b rejoins and mirrors sync, repeat for node-a. Verify protocol version in the admin panel. Sign the upgraded package manifest with the deploy key shown below.

deploy key for kajof-fajop: bky6_gDHw9Q

The Ledgerline schema registry ships as a single container and must be deployed before any event producers restart, since producers fail closed when schema lookups miss. Release managers should drain the old instance only after the replication lag metric reads zero. Compatibility mode is enforced at register time, so breaking schema changes are rejected rather than versioned silently. Blue-green cutover is supported; keep both instances pointed at the same backing store. On startup the registry reads the configuration shown below.

deployment values, kajep-kageg:
[praix]
host = praix.paliqcorp.corp
user = praix_svc
database = praix_prod